An Indian delegation headed by Chief of Defence Staff General Anil Chauhan is visiting Armenia on a pivotal official mission, marking significant strides in shared strategic interests and reinforcing the long-standing defence partnership between the two countries.
The Headquarters Integrated Defence Staff (HQ IDS) revealed updates on the ongoing four-day visit via social media, sharing glimpses of the Indian team's engagements. During the visit, Gen Chauhan participated in a wreath-laying ceremony at the Armenian Genocide Memorial & Museum in Yerevan, paying homage to the lives lost in the genocide.
The delegation enjoyed a warm reception in Yerevan, underscored by a ceremony from the Armenian Armed Forces. This visit highlights the strengthening bilateral ties and the enduring India-Armenia friendship.
